Technology Sales Representative
Location:
Lubbock, TX or Frisco, TX (on-site).
We are seeking a Technology Sales Representative to drive revenue growth through proactive lead generation, pipeline development, and client engagement. The role involves collaborating with sales leadership, utilizing CRM platforms, and executing outbound campaigns across phone, email, and in‑person channels to generate qualified opportunities and build a strong pipeline.
